How they compare
Egypt currently reports 99.8% against 99.7% in Croatia, a difference of 0.1%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 12 shared years of data; in 1999 it was Croatia ahead.
Croatia ranks 8th and Egypt ranks 6th of 180 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Croatia averaged higher in 2 and Egypt in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Croatia | Egypt |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 99.4% | 99.1% | 0.3% | Croatia |
| 2000s | 99.4% | 95.5% | 3.9% | Croatia |
| 2010s | 97.6% | 98.0% | 0.4% | Egypt |
| 2020s | 98.5% | 99.8% | 1.3% | Egypt |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
